www.space.com/scienceastronomy/neptune_moons_030113.html New Moons of Neptune are First Discovered Since 1989 By Robert Roy Britt Senior Science Writer posted: 12:40 pm ET 13 January 2003 Astronomers announced today the discovery of three previously unseen moons orbiting Neptune, bringing the total of satellites around that planet to 11. seds.lpl.arizona.edu/nineplanets/nineplanets/neptune.html Neptune has 13 known moons; 7 small named ones and Triton plus four discovered in 2002 and one discovered in 2003 which have yet to be named.
